All-on-4 & full-arch implants in Hungary: cost and the real timeline
Full-arch restoration — a complete row of fixed teeth on four to six implants — is the biggest-ticket treatment in dentistry, which makes it the case where travelling saves the most in absolute pounds: commonly £5,000+ per arch. It's also the treatment most wrapped in marketing. Here's how it actually works.
What it costs
| Treatment | Typical UK priceTypical Canadian price | In Hungary | Saving |
|---|---|---|---|
| Full-arch fixed restoration (per arch) | £10,000–£14,000CA$18,000–$30,000 | £4,500–£6,500CA$7,500–$11,000 | up to 60% |
| Both arches | £20,000–£28,000CA$36,000–$60,000 | £9,000–£13,000CA$15,000–$22,000 | up to 60% |
Guide ranges from published private price lists, 2026. Full-arch quotes vary more than any other treatment — bone, extractions, materials and provisional type all move the number. The written plan is everything here.
What All-on-4 actually is
Four (sometimes five or six) implants per jaw, with the rear ones placed at a calculated angle to anchor in the best available bone — often avoiding the grafts that individual implants would need. A full fixed bridge attaches to those implants: teeth that don't move, don't come out at night, and load the jawbone the way natural teeth do, which is what keeps the bone from receding the way it does under dentures.
It's a genuine, well-established technique — and also the most aggressively marketed phrase in dental tourism, so keep the label separate from the clinic: a bad clinic doing "All-on-4" is still a bad clinic. The vetting rules apply double at this ticket size.
The real timeline: provisional now, final later
Full-arch is the one implant treatment where same-week fixed teeth are legitimate — with a caveat every honest clinic states plainly:
- Visit one (5–8 days): CT planning, any extractions, implant placement, and — because All-on-4 is engineered for immediate loading — a fixed provisional bridge fitted within days. You fly home with fixed teeth, eating soft foods carefully.
- At home (3–6 months): the implants integrate under the provisional. Follow the food rules; this stage is where the long-term result is won.
- Visit two (5–8 days): the definitive bridge — stronger materials, refined fit and bite — replaces the provisional.
The mis-selling pattern to watch: presenting the provisional as the finished product and skipping visit two from the quote. Ask any clinic: "Is the final bridge included, and what is it made of?" If the answer is vague, so is the price.
Full-arch or dentures — the honest fork
Dentures cost a fraction of this, involve no surgery, and a well-made set serves many people well — if that's you, you don't need us. Fixed full-arch teeth earn their price when dentures genuinely fail you: moving when you speak, restricting what you eat, the daily out-at-night ritual, accelerating bone loss. That's a quality-of-life purchase with a £5,000+ discount for making the trip — which is why it's the case we most often see justify travelling twice. Frequently asked questions
How much does All-on-4 cost in Hungary?
Typically £4,500–£6,500 per arch (about CA$7,500–$11,000), against £10,000–£14,000 in the UK or CA$18,000–$30,000 in Canada — the largest absolute savings of any dental treatment, commonly £5,000+ per arch.
Do I really get teeth the same week?
Yes — a fixed provisional bridge, typically fitted within days of placement; All-on-4 is engineered for immediate loading. The definitive final bridge is made at a second visit 3–6 months later. Anyone presenting the provisional as the finished product is skipping half the treatment.
I've been told I don't have enough bone — am I still a candidate?
Often yes: the angled rear implants use the bone you have and frequently avoid grafting. But a CT scan decides, not a sales page — send your X-rays and get a written plan before booking anything.
All-on-4 or dentures?
Fixed teeth don't move, don't come out at night, and preserve jawbone; dentures cost far less and avoid surgery. If a well-fitted denture serves you, that's a valid answer — full-arch implants are for the people it doesn't. An honest clinic walks you through both.
